First up in our exciting 'my ship's bigger than yours' competition is Guy Thompson, a solicitor at Birkett Long in Chelmsford. He bought Iris (pictured) off the Internet two years ago. At 52 foot long, she is one of the largest lifeboats of her type and served in the Shetlands from 1961 to 1982. As a keen sailor, Mr Thompson decided Iris would be a good addition to the family and has even entertained clients on board. It is not known whether he has had to effect any rescues, which might make his entry unbeatable even at this early stage, but he has certainly thrown down the gauntlet to any would-be challengers.
